Miramar Projects also operates a substantial painting division. The painting service covers new constructions as well as the restoration and repainting of existing buildings, including residential complexes and high-rise structures. The approach highlights careful surface preparation and product selection as keys to longevity and protective finishes. The company collaborates with major paint brands such as Dulux, Plascon, Dekade and Prodec, and is described as an approved applicator for additional brands, offering a broad range of products and access to specialist technical support.

Practical tips for potential customers include: clearly documenting the brief and desired outcomes, requesting detailed, staged cost estimates, and seeking a transparent plan for timelines and progress updates. It is advisable to confirm NHBRC registration and professional affiliations where relevant, and to discuss colour schemes and paint specifications early, leveraging the company’s connections with major paint brands for product suitability and long-term performance. Contractor Services in Durban, KwaZulu-Natal: A Practical Overview
In Durban, KwaZulu-Natal, contractor services span a broad spectrum of construction, repair and maintenance work. Projects commonly range from small residential repairs and refurbishments to larger extensions and commercial renovations. Across the coastal city, reputable contractors bring together trades such as carpentry, brickwork, roofing, plumbing, electrical, painting and tiling to deliver comprehensive outcomes. The emphasis is typically on reliability, quality workmanship and adherence to local scheduling expectations in a climate that can include heavy rains and tropical heat.
Clients can expect a staged approach to most contracts. Initial discussions usually establish the scope of work, budget and a realistic timetable. A site visit enables the contractor to assess conditions, identify potential challenges and outline the sequence of trades required. Following this, a written quotation or provisional estimate is provided, detailing materials, labour, expected durations and any dependencies on external parties. Clear communication about milestones helps both sides track progress and manage cash flow, which is particularly important in Durban where weather can influence outdoor activities such as roofing, paving and exterior repairs.
Electrical and plumbing services are among the common offerings. Electrical work typically covers safety inspections, upgrades, installations and fault finding, carried out by licensed professionals. Plumbing encompasses repairs to leaks, fittings replacement and more complex installations for kitchens and bathrooms. In all cases, compliance with basic safety standards and local regulations is emphasised, and some projects may require permits or inspections before proceeding to subsequent stages.
Building and carpentry form a substantial portion of Durban’s contractor activity. This includes structural repairs, wall or floor renovations, door and window replacements, cabinetmaking and customised joinery. Roofing remains a frequent focus, with tasks such as repairs to tiles, gables or waterproofing, plus gutter maintenance to mitigate seasonal rainfall. External works, including bricklaying, plastering, painting and finishing, are commonly coordinated to address both cosmetic and structural needs. For many projects, weather protection measures and site safety protocols are integral parts of planning, given the city’s humid climate and occasional heavy rain.
Maintenance programmes are another important facet. Regular upkeep to homes and commercial properties can involve landscape drainage, deck refinishing, fence repair, air conditioning servicing and minor refurbishment. These services help prevent larger, more disruptive problems and support property value over time. Across Durban, contractors often offer advice on energy efficiency improvements, such as insulation or sealing projects, which can be beneficial in both hot summers and cooler winter periods.
